Output 2ed586d42f2491b6992b3f513c369c0883407eca8531de52e4f4e4dc1c40374c:0

value
563018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762e4e9e626b788a2a5cfd8440a1c12f3f79da1a OP_EQUAL
address
3CTu8esUj5eQ3YW87vo8T3VUyNgfjHgjbR
transaction
2ed586d42f2491b6992b3f513c369c0883407eca8531de52e4f4e4dc1c40374c
confirmations
223654
spent
true